Ducktales Remastered

We all know the characters, the theme song, and for many of us, we remember the great side scrolling adventure game from the 1990’s. In an effort to bring fans back to a simpler time, or just for pure nostalgia, Capcom and Disney Interactive have teamed up for ‘DuckTales: Remastered’, which is now available to download on PS3, Xbox 360, PC, and Wii U, for $14.99.

As the Press release adds, this was one of the most well known platform games at the time of its release in 1989:

Originally released in 1989 on the Nintendo Entertainment System™, DuckTales was widely acknowledged as one of the generation’s seminal platform titles. DuckTales: Remastered once again follows the adventures of Scrooge McDuck and his nephews – Huey, Dewey and Louie, as they explore different themed worlds on their search for five legendary treasures.
